How To Use Data And Analytics To Improve Your Spotify Reach

If you’re an artist sharing your music on Spotify, you’ve probably wondered how to get more people to hear your songs. The good news is, Spotify gives you helpful tools to see how your music is doing. By using this data, you can figure out what’s working and what you might want to change. Over time, this can give your reach a real boost. At buzzclick-music.com, we’re all about helping artists grow—so let’s talk about how you can use data and analytics to reach more listeners.

The first place to start is with Spotify for Artists. It’s a free tool that shows you how people are finding and listening to your music. You'll see things like how many streams each song is getting, where your fans live, and how they’re listening (like if it’s through playlists or their own libraries). This kind of info can help you decide what songs to promote, which cities to focus your social media or touring efforts on, and who your audience really is.

Next, take a look at the playlist data. Are your songs being added to user-made playlists? If so, which ones? This can tell you a lot about what kind of listeners like your songs. If a certain track is doing well on workout or chill playlists, for example, that might be a clue to the mood your music sets—and that’s something you can lean into with your branding and new releases.

Demographic data is also important. Knowing the age and location of your listeners can shape the way you talk to your audience. If most of your listeners are in their 20s and live in big cities, your social media tone and content can reflect that lifestyle.

And don’t forget about tracking your growth. Are more people listening month-to-month? If not, look at what changed. Did you stop posting on social media? Did you release fewer songs? Try to connect the dots between your actions and your numbers.
